What is being bought
The Secretary of State for Defence intends to award a contract to Viasat UK Ltd for the provision of quantity ten Link 16 Joint Tactical Radio System (JTRS) Mobile Crates, for the T45 and QEC platforms under the Maritime Multi-Link (MML) Project. This is the only product currently on the market that meets both the technical requirement and access size restrictions of both the T45 and QEC platforms, mitigating the need to cut metal and reducing the risk of installation.
The Cyber Risk profile is Very Low. The reference for the RA is: RAR-J9K6MBSB.
